What affects donation value
The value of your Chrysler donation is influenced by several factors, including the model, year, condition, and market demand. Vehicles like the Chrysler 300 and Pacifica are particularly valuable due to their reliability and popularity among buyers. Additionally, if your vehicle is older and well-maintained, it may qualify for a higher appraisal, especially if it’s a rare model like the Hemi 300C. It’s important to note IRS regulations for tax deductions, where vehicles valued over $5,000 require an appraisal using IRS Form 8283. This helps ensure you receive the maximum deduction possible while supporting your favorite local causes.
